!basis for social cognition: knowledge of perceptions, ideas, and actions of others. Mapping actions of others facilitate social understanding. Imitation, cooperation: understanding of an action not to some superficial aspect of it. Fire equally as robustly if watch a peanut open (and make noise) or if just hear the noise: fire to the action, regardless of how it was detected. Mirror neurons found in pp lobe: respond to purpose of the action. Respond to food if grasp food and eaten, little response if grasp food and its placed in a bowl. Same neurons respond to experimenter picking up food to eat it, but not if it was placed elsewhere and not eaten.
